Official abstract text for this publication.
A user equipment (UE) that includes one or more non-transitory computer-readable media storing one or more computer-executable instructions for processing channel state information (CSI) and at least one processor coupled to the one or more non-transitory computer-readable media is provided. The processor is configured to execute the one or more computer-executable instructions to cause the UE to receive first information from a base station (BS) regarding a plurality of occasions to transmit a CSI report at each of the plurality of occasions; receive second information from the BS to identify one or more durations during which the UE determines whether to forgo processing the CSI for the CSI report; process the CSI for first occasions of the plurality of occasions that are not within the one or more durations; and forgo processing the CSI for second occasions of the plurality of occasions that are within the one or more durations.

What is claimed is: 1 . A user equipment (UE), comprising: one or more non-transitory computer-readable media storing one or more computer-executable instructions for processing channel state information (CSI); and at least one processor coupled to the one or more non-transitory computer-readable media, and configured to execute the one or more computer-executable instructions to cause the UE to: receive first information from a base station (BS) regarding a plurality of occasions to transmit a CSI report at each of the plurality of occasions; receive second information from the BS to identify one or more durations during which the UE determines whether to forgo processing the CSI for the CSI report; process the CSI for first occasions of the plurality of occasions that are not within the one or more durations; and forgo processing the CSI for second occasions of the plurality of occasions that are within the one or more durations. 2 . The UE of claim 1 , wherein the at least one processor is further configured to execute the one or more instructions to cause the UE to transmit the CSI report at the first occasions. 3 . The UE of claim 1 , wherein the first information is received through one of a radio resource control (RRC) message, a medium access control (MAC) control element (CE), or a downlink control information (DCI). 4 . The UE of claim 1 , wherein the second information is received through one of a radio resource control (RRC) message, a medium access control (MAC) control element (CE), or a downlink control information (DCI). 5 . The UE of claim 1 , wherein the first and second information are received through a same one of a radio resource control (RRC) message, a medium access control (MAC) control element (CE), or a downlink control information (DCI). 6 . The UE of claim 1 , wherein forgoing processing the CSI comprises: forgoing updating the CSI for the CSI report. 7 . The UE of claim 6 , wherein forgoing processing the CSI further comprises forgoing transmitting the CSI report to the BS at the second occasions. 8 . The UE of claim 6 , wherein foregoing processing the CSI further comprises transmitting a previously transmitted CSI report to the BS at the second occasions. 9 . The UE of claim 1 , wherein foregoing processing the CSI comprises transmitting the CSI report to the BS at the second occasions, wherein the CSI report comprises a channel quality indicator (CQI) field comprising a specific code point indicating that a channel quality of a link from the BS to the UE is below a threshold. 10 . The UE of claim 1 , wherein: foregoing processing the CSI comprises transmitting the CSI report to the BS at the second occasions, the CSI report comprises a combination of a first specific code point of a channel quality indicator (CQI) field and a second specific code point of a rank indicator (RI) field, the first specific code point is ‘0’ in decimal number, and the second specific code point is one of a code point indicating a maximum transmission rank and a code point that is reserved, or is not used, for the CSI report. 11 . The UE of claim 1 , wherein the CSI report conveys information related to the propagation path between the UE and the BS. 12 . The UE of claim 1 , wherein the at least one processor is further configured to execute the one or more instructions to cause the UE to: transmit a capability report to the BS indicating information associated with the one or more durations in terms of one or more of a length of the durations and a periodicity of the durations; and receive the information to identify the one or more durations from the BS in response to transmitting the capability report. 13 . The UE of claim 1 , further comprising: a higher-layer processing unit configured to transmit an indication to forgo processing the CSI; and a wireless transmission and reception unit configured to process the CSI for the CSI report for the first occasions even after receiving the indication from the higher-layer processing unit. 14 . The UE of claim 1 , further comprising: a higher-layer processing unit configured to transmit an indication to forgo processing the CSI; and a wireless transmission and reception unit configured to forgo processing the CSI for the CSI report for the second occasions after receiving the indication from the higher-layer processing unit. 15 . A method of processing channel state information (CSI) by a user equipment (UE), the method comprising: receiving first information from a base station (BS) regarding a plurality of occasions to transmit a CSI report at each of the plurality of occasions; receiving second information from the BS to identify one or more durations during which the UE determines whether to forgo processing the CSI for the CSI report; processing the CSI for first occasions of the plurality of occasions that are not within the one or more durations; and forgoing processing the CSI for second occasions of the plurality of occasions that are within the one or more durations.
